ARCHIVE. Flooding in Germany, 2013, Town of Lauenburg
The low-lying old district of Lauenburg, a riverside town east of Hamburg, was evacuated. Yesterday Angela Merkel visited Lauenburg, whose picturesque centre of half-timbered houses is under water. Soldiers and volunteers have worked frantically over the past week to fill sandbags and reinforce flood defenses across central Europe but some places like the old part of Lauenburg could not be saved.
